Essential

Functions
  • Under the direction of the Director of Parks & Recreation, the Recreation Program Superintendent oversees City sponsored recreation activities, recreation facilities and the Jack Florance outdoor swimming pool. This position is subject to emergency callouts and must be able to work overtime including nights and weekends and stand-by as required.
  • Oversees and participates in the management of a comprehensive recreation program; manages and supervises the work of all assigned employees; interviews and recommends the hiring of full-time, part-time, seasonal and intermittent staff; schedules and assigns tasks; recommends discipline; recommends pay assignments; evaluates performance; receives and adjusts grievances or employee complaints; approves and recommends the approval of leave requests; attends or participates in meetings in which policy questions are reviewed or discussed;

    develops and implements policy; recommends policy changes; participates in department budget development and administration for areas of oversight; monitors department expenditures and revenues and recommends adjustments as necessary.
  • Assesses needs, develops, implements, and evaluates pre-and post-cost analysis of a variety of programs, facility operations and services associated with the city’s recreation and outdoor pool programs, including but not limited to special activities, recreation classes, community events, leagues, camps, trips, facilities, and services.
  • Oversees the facility operations of the Mingo Recreation Center. Inspects facilities for safety and cleanliness, ensures safety of patrons in facility and addresses safety concerns.
  • Oversees the physical maintenance, the management of operations, the development of programs and services, and all safety processes related to the outdoor pool facility before, during, and after the normal pool season.
  • Researches, selects, and evaluates contractual program providers.
  • Develops and delivers program-specific and safety staff training to assure the safety of program delivery.
  • Oversees the responsibility for recreation software system in the performance of duties.
  • Promotes and coordinates the activities and operations of the Recreation division; participates in public relations and communicates information on programming by providing outreach to schools, non-profit organizations, citizens, and community groups; participates in city-wide special events and related functions.
  • Develops, establishes, and monitors partnerships with local resources including the YMCA, DYAA, youth sports leagues city schools and any independent contractor agreements with private recreation providers.
  • Participates in the development and implementation of division goals, objectives, policies and priorities; recommends, implements and enforces department procedures.
  • Identifies opportunities for improving programming; identifies, reviews, and makes recommendations on improvements. Prepares a variety of reports and records related to operations and activities of the division.
